John Walker
John is President of ManageMen, Inc. and the founder of Janitor University. He has over 30 years of experience in the cleaning industry. John specializes in the ManageMen Operating System (OS1)® , Functional Management, Training, Workloading, Strategic Long Range Planning, and Organizational Change Issues. He was the first Director of Education for the International Sanitary Supply Association (ISSA).
John is an industry expert and the author of a variety of books on professional cleaning, numerous pamphlets, training booklets and articles. His best selling ISSA Official 447 Cleaning Times is the accepted standard reference book for cleaning industry work times. John is widely known for his enthusiasm and energetic training style.

Charles Hollis, Sr.
Charles Hollis joins ManageMen as (OS1) Trainer/Coach specializing in Boot Camps for new (OS1) start-ups as well as advising/consulting established (OS1) organizations in there retuning efforts.
For 15 years, Charles managed 80-100 Janitorial Services cleaning employees at Sandia National Laboratories Facilities Department, Albuquerque, NM., a multi-program laboratory operated by Sandia Corporation, a Lockheed Martin company, for the US Department of Energy’s National Nuclear Security Administration. After seven years in this role, Sandia Janitorial Services embraced the ManageMen (OS1) Cleaning Methodology and Charles became a member of the Functional Management Team, with a primary function as the (OS1) Trainer for his cleaning organization. During his tenure as trainer he was a pioneer in the establishment of the (OS1) “Learn N Earn Certification Program” that was eventually adopted and renewed as part of the union contract by the Metal Trades and Aerospace Workers union of AFL-CIO.
Charles was a major force behind Sandia being recognized as a premier cleaning organization with Sandia receiving three Best Cleaning Program “Grammy” Awards in five years and three consecutive Green Certified Program Awards. A highlight of Charles’ training career occurred at the 2007 (OS1) Users Symposium Awards in Colonial Williamsburg when Sandia National Labs was recognized as the Best Cleaning Industry Training Program.
Charles’ current certifications include (OS1) Expert Trainer and (OS1) Certified Coach.
John Downey
John Downey heads ManageMen’s (OS1) Carpet Care program. In his position he co-teaches the (OS1) Carpet Care Workshop and conducts field audits, Boot Camps and Retunings for (OS1) Carpet Care users.
Downey is a fourth-generation carpet cleaner whose family business dates to 1897, Downey’s experience and contributions to the industry span 35 years and an impressive array of activities:
• His cleaning experience dates to his high school years working in the family business. In addition to carpet, rug and upholstery cleaning he has several years of hands-on experience in carpet dyeing and textile inspections.
• In 1989 Downey founded Cleanfax, a magazine dedicated to meeting the needs of professional carpet cleaners. Under his leadership, Cleanfax became the industry’s leading and most influential trade magazine. He sold Cleanfax to National Trade Publications in 1997 and continued as its editor until 2000.
• Beginning during his Cleanfax days, Downey has worked with the carpet manufacturing industry. His efforts have helped bridge the long-time chasm that separated the companies that manufacture carpet from those who maintain it. In recent years he has worked with both individual carpet manufacturers as well as the industry’s trade association, the Carpet and Rug Institute (CRI), in the areas of facility carpet care and assessing the impact of carpet on indoor air quality (both before and after proper maintenance procedures are implemented).
Since 2000, Downey has been particularly focused on the needs and shortcomings of facility carpet maintenance. His work in this area has given him a keen understanding of the need for a systematic approach to facility carpet care, which is why he is excited at the opportunity to work with ManageMen.
